200+ Tests failing on Lollipop Tablet Tester |
||
Issue descriptionFirst failing build: https://uberchromegw.corp.google.com/i/chromium.android/builders/Lollipop%20Tablet%20Tester/builds/5269/ There might be something fishy with the ChromeActivity or TabModelUtils, some of the failures at least seem related. They don't repro locally. Still investigating. +tedchoc@: FYI as other sheriff +jbudorick@: Is there an ongoing known issue about that bot specifically?
,
Oct 11 2016
chrome_public_test_apk passed in the next build, that was maybe just an issue with the bot. https://uberchromegw.corp.google.com/i/chromium.android/builders/Lollipop%20Tablet%20Tester/builds/5274
,
Oct 12 2016
Didn't happen again in the following 10 or so builds. Closing.
,
Oct 18 2016
Sorry about my lack of response, was OOO last week. Lots of these in the exception traces: Caused by: java.lang.NullPointerException: Attempt to invoke virtual method 'org.chromium.content_public.browser.WebContents org.chromium.content.browser.ContentViewCore.getWebContents()' on a null object reference at org.chromium.chrome.browser.payments.PaymentRequestTestBase$1.run(PaymentRequestTestBase.java:138)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:422) at java.util.concurrent.FutureTask.run(FutureTask.java:237) at android.os.Handler.handleCallback(Handler.java:739) at android.os.Handler.dispatchMessage(Handler.java:95) at android.os.Looper.loop(Looper.java:135) at android.app.ActivityThread.main(ActivityThread.java:5254)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:903)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:698) from https://uberchromegw.corp.google.com/i/chromium.android/builders/Lollipop%20Tablet%20Tester/builds/5269/steps/chrome_public_test_apk%3A%20generate%20result%20details/logs/result_details |
||
►
Sign in to add a comment |
||
Comment 1 by tedc...@chromium.org
, Oct 11 2016Hmm...and nothing jumping out in the logs either. Dump of logs prior to the crash in: MainActivityWithURLTest#testLaunchActivityWithURL 94402: 10-11 03:02:44.449 3659 3689 W chromium: [1011/030244:WARNING:trace_config_file.cc(80)] The trace config file does not exist. 94402: 10-11 03:02:44.449 3659 3689 I chromium: [INFO:library_loader_hooks.cc(163)] Chromium logging enabled: level = 0, default verbosity = 0 94402: 10-11 03:02:44.457 3659 3689 E libEGL : validate_display:255 error 3008 (EGL_BAD_DISPLAY) 94402: 10-11 03:02:44.458 3659 3689 I Adreno-EGL: <qeglDrvAPI_eglInitialize:379>: QUALCOMM Build: 01/15/15, ab0075f, Id3510ff6dc 94402: 10-11 03:02:44.499 3583 3583 I art : Rejecting re-init on previously-failed class java.lang.Class<org.chromium.content.browser.FloatingWebActionModeCallback> 94402: 10-11 03:02:44.499 3583 3583 I art : Rejecting re-init on previously-failed class java.lang.Class<org.chromium.content.browser.FloatingWebActionModeCallback> 94402: 10-11 03:02:44.509 3659 3691 W chromium: [WARNING:persistent_histogram_allocator.cc(502)] Creating the results-histogram inside persistent memory can cause future allocations to crash if that memor y is ever released (for testing). 94402: 10-11 03:02:44.545 3659 3689 W VideoCapabilities: Unsupported mime video/mpeg2 94402: 10-11 03:02:44.567 3659 3689 I VideoCapabilities: Unsupported profile 4 for video/mp4v-es 94402: 10-11 03:02:44.647 3583 3653 D cr_ChildProcLauncher: [ChildProcessLauncher.java:773] Setting up connection to process: slot=0 94402: 10-11 03:02:44.652 3623 3641 I cr_LibraryLoader: Using linker: org.chromium.base.library_loader.LegacyLinker 94402: 10-11 03:02:44.653 3583 3653 D cr_ChildProcLauncher: [ChildProcessLauncher.java:811] on connect callback, pid=3623 context=-1362769616 callbackType=2 94402: 10-11 03:02:44.654 3623 3643 W linker : libchromium_android_linker.so: unused DT entry: type 0x6ffffffe arg 0x41f8 94402: 10-11 03:02:44.654 3623 3643 W linker : libchromium_android_linker.so: unused DT entry: type 0x6fffffff arg 0x3 94402: 10-11 03:02:44.654 551 581 D BluetoothManagerService: Message: 20 94402: 10-11 03:02:44.654 551 581 D BluetoothManagerService: Added callback: android.bluetooth.IBluetoothManagerCallback$Stub$Proxy@ba67a64:true 94402: 10-11 03:02:44.656 3583 3657 D BluetoothAdapter: 485851751: getState() : mService = null. Returning STATE_OFF 94402: 10-11 03:02:44.670 3623 3643 I cr_LibraryLoader: Loading chrome 94402: 10-11 03:02:44.734 3583 3583 W chromium: [WARNING:popular_sites.cc(375)] Download country site list failed 94402: 10-11 03:02:44.793 3623 3643 I cr_LibraryLoader: Time to load native libraries: 123 ms (timestamps 8189-8312) 94402: 10-11 03:02:44.793 3623 3643 I cr_LibraryLoader: Expected native library version number "56.0.2887.0", actual native library version number "56.0.2887.0" 94402: 10-11 03:02:44.795 3623 3643 W chromium: [1011/030244:WARNING:trace_config_file.cc(80)] The trace config file does not exist. 94402: 10-11 03:02:44.795 3623 3643 I chromium: [INFO:library_loader_hooks.cc(163)] Chromium logging enabled: level = 0, default verbosity = 0 94402: 10-11 03:02:44.831 3583 3583 D cr_Ntp : [NewTabPageAdapter.java:229] Received 0 new suggestions for category 10001. 94402: 10-11 03:02:44.839 3583 3583 D cr_FeatureUtilities: [FeatureUtilities.java:208] Experiment flavor: Elderberry 94402: 10-11 03:02:44.840 3583 3583 D cr_FeatureUtilities: [FeatureUtilities.java:223] Caching flavor: Elderberry 94402: 10-11 03:02:44.853 3623 3700 W chromium: [WARNING:persistent_histogram_allocator.cc(502)] Creating the results-histogram inside persistent memory can cause future allocations to crash if that memor y is ever released (for testing). 94402: 10-11 03:02:44.868 3583 3583 W chromium: [WARNING:popular_sites.cc(381)] Download fallback site list failed 94402: 10-11 03:02:44.868 3583 3583 W chromium: [WARNING:most_visited_sites.cc(517)] Download of popular sites failed 94402: 10-11 03:02:44.904 3583 3583 W View : requestLayout() improperly called by android.support.v7.widget.AppCompatTextView{195d6ab0 V.ED.... ......ID 96,1662-1104,1742} during layout: running second layout pass 94402: 10-11 03:02:44.975 3583 3583 I cr_Ime : ImeThread is enabled. 94402: 10-11 03:02:45.072 3583 3583 D cr_OfflinePageUtils: [OfflinePageUtils.java:208] building snackbar controller 94402: 10-11 03:02:45.104 3583 3583 D cr_tabmodel: [TabPersistentStore.java:828] Serializing tab lists; counts: 1, 0, 0 94402: 10-11 03:02:45.109 3583 3583 W View : requestLayout() improperly called by android.support.v7.widget.AppCompatTextView{195d6ab0 V.ED.... ......ID 96,1662-1104,1662} during second layout pass: po sting in next frame 94402: 10-11 03:02:45.240 3583 3601 D ChromeActivityTestCaseBase: startActivityCompletely << 94402: 10-11 03:02:45.287 3583 3614 W cr_CrashFileManager: /data/data/org.chromium.chrome/cache/Crash Reports does not exist! 94402: 10-11 03:02:45.287 3583 3614 W cr_CrashFileManager: /data/data/org.chromium.chrome/cache/Crash Reports does not exist! 94402: 10-11 03:02:45.287 3583 3614 W cr_CrashFileManager: /data/data/org.chromium.chrome/cache/Crash Reports does not exist! 94402: 10-11 03:02:45.291 3583 3614 V cr_Precache: [PrecacheLauncher.java:139] updateEnabled starting 94402: 10-11 03:02:45.305 3583 3709 W cr_CrashFileManager: /data/data/org.chromium.chrome/cache/Crash Reports does not exist! 94402: 10-11 03:02:45.305 3583 3709 W cr_CrashFileManager: /data/data/org.chromium.chrome/cache/Crash Reports does not exist! 94402: 10-11 03:02:45.306 3583 3709 I cr_MinidmpUploadService: Attempting to upload accumulated crash dumps. 94402: 10-11 03:02:45.345 3583 3583 V cr_Precache: [PrecacheLauncher.java:162] updateEnabled complete 94402: 10-11 03:02:45.347 3583 3583 I cr_BindingManager: Moderate binding enabled: maxSize=20 94402: 10-11 03:02:45.377 3583 3710 W GooglePlayServicesUtil: Google Play services out of date. Requires 8487000 but found 6779436 94402: 10-11 03:02:45.378 3583 3583 D NearbyMessagesClient: Failed to emit client lifecycle event CLIENT_DISCONNECTED due to GmsClient being disconnected 94402: 10-11 03:02:45.379 3583 3583 I cr_PhysicalWeb: Nearby connection failed: ConnectionResult{statusCode=SERVICE_VERSION_UPDATE_REQUIRED, resolution=null, message=null} 94402: 10-11 03:02:45.385 3583 3583 W GooglePlayServicesUtil: Google Play services out of date. Requires 8487000 but found 6779436 94402: 10-11 03:02:45.386 3583 3583 V cr_ExternalAuthUtils: [ExternalAuthUtils.java:188] Unable to use Google Play Services: SERVICE_VERSION_UPDATE_REQUIRED 94402: 10-11 03:02:45.388 3583 3583 W GooglePlayServicesUtil: Google Play services out of date. Requires 8487000 but found 6779436 94402: 10-11 03:02:45.388 3583 3583 V cr_ExternalAuthUtils: [ExternalAuthUtils.java:188] Unable to use Google Play Services: SERVICE_VERSION_UPDATE_REQUIRED 94402: 10-11 03:02:45.809 551 1329 I WindowManager: Screenshot max retries 4 of Token{2267a3d4 ActivityRecord{2ef2e527 u0 org.chromium.chrome/.browser.ChromeTabbedActivity t201 f}} appWin=Window{256ecbed u0 SurfaceView} drawState=4 94402: 10-11 03:02:45.812 551 642 W art : Long monitor contention event with owner method=void com.android.server.am.ActivityManagerService$AppTaskImpl.finishAndRemoveTask() from ActivityManagerServ ice.java:19647 waiters=0 for 217ms 94402: 10-11 03:02:45.845 551 622 D ConnectivityService: releasing NetworkRequest NetworkRequest [ id=204, legacyType=-1, [ Capabilities: INTERNET&NOT_RESTRICTED&TRUSTED] ] 94402: 10-11 03:02:45.850 3583 3682 D ConnectivityManager.CallbackHandler: CM callback handler got msg 524296 94402: 10-11 03:02:45.858 551 1801 W ActivityManager: Finishing task with all activities already finished 94402: 10-11 03:02:45.858 551 1801 W ActivityManager: Duplicate finish request for ActivityRecord{2ef2e527 u0 org.chromium.chrome/.browser.ChromeTabbedActivity t201 f} 94402: 10-11 03:02:45.947 3583 3598 I art : Background sticky concurrent mark sweep GC freed 19474(1639KB) AllocSpace objects, 33(568KB) LOS objects, 11% free, 16MB/18MB, paused 3.082ms total 129.791ms 94402: 10-11 03:02:45.947 3583 3601 I art : WaitForGcToComplete blocked for 88.134ms for cause Explicit 94402: 10-11 03:02:45.997 3583 3601 I art : Explicit concurrent mark sweep GC freed 1462(121KB) AllocSpace objects, 2(30KB) LOS objects, 40% free, 15MB/26MB, paused 2.197ms total 49.346ms 94402: 10-11 03:02:46.032 3583 3583 D cr_tabmodel: [TabPersistentStore.java:828] Serializing tab lists; counts: 1, 0, 0 94402: 10-11 03:02:46.044 3583 3601 I art : Explicit concurrent mark sweep GC freed 427(73KB) AllocSpace objects, 2(1869KB) LOS objects, 39% free, 14MB/23MB, paused 1.525ms total 44.372ms ----------------- Downloaded logcat file from the build you pointed to and did: grep -A300 "START org.chromium.chrome.browser.MainActivityWithURLTest#testLaunchActivityWithURL" logcat_dumps%2FLollipop\ Tablet\ Tester%2F5269 | less